![[안드로이드/StatusBar] 앱 상태바 색상 변경하는 방법](https://img1.daumcdn.net/thumb/R750x0/?scode=mtistory2&fname=https%3A%2F%2Fblog.kakaocdn.net%2Fdna%2FcZp8A3%2FbtsFoJZDq6J%2FAAAAAAAAAAAAAAAAAAAAAGXpFePIRnY-aKV4WfrEJEvgihRogFMCKG0u4WXpZ7MR%2Fimg.png%3Fcredential%3DyqXZFxpELC7KVnFOS48ylbz2pIh7yKj8%26expires%3D1756652399%26allow_ip%3D%26allow_referer%3D%26signature%3DYl1QZ2R8LVaNgUhrJdz529c1dy4%253D)
안드로이드 스튜디오에서 애뮬레이터를 작동하시다 보면 맨 위 상단 색상이 항상 고정되어 있습니다. 오늘은 간단하게 색상을 변경 하는 방법을 알려드립니다. 앱 상태바 색상 변경하는 방법 보통 앱을 키시면 상단에 보라색으로 고정이 되어있으실 겁니다. res -> values -> themes ->themes.xml을 가셔서 @color/white 위 코드 또는 #ffffff 위 코드를 총코드에서 Jucoding_Tistory는 자신이 만든 프로젝트 이름입니다. 앱 상태바 색상 변경 전 / 후
![[안드로이드/ButtonColor] 버튼 색상 변경하는 방법](https://img1.daumcdn.net/thumb/R750x0/?scode=mtistory2&fname=https%3A%2F%2Fblog.kakaocdn.net%2Fdna%2F2Q7wi%2FbtsFml5jSgu%2FAAAAAAAAAAAAAAAAAAAAAIdJ-ltebfurB_uzhuUCTT_bR01B7AJqXRoQZ0mO4jz1%2Fimg.png%3Fcredential%3DyqXZFxpELC7KVnFOS48ylbz2pIh7yKj8%26expires%3D1756652399%26allow_ip%3D%26allow_referer%3D%26signature%3DnWFZDiYsvx4RTnuGLNZeVint3C0%253D)
안드로이드 스튜디오에서 버튼 색상을 변경하려고 해도 변경이 되지 않고 색상이 보라색으로 고정되어있으실 겁니다. 그래서 버튼 색상을 바꿀 수 있는 두가지 방법을 설명드리려고 합니다. 그 이전에 버튼 색상이 변경이 되지 않는 이유까지 살펴보고 알려드리겠습니다. 버튼 색상이 변경 되지 않는 이유 안드로이드 스튜디오는 기본설정으로 Material3 디자인을 상속받고 있습니다. ( 기본 설정값은 안드로이드 스튜디오 버전에 따라 다를 수 있습니다. ) 이 기본 설정을 확인 하려면 res / values / themes / themes.xml 에 있는 코드를 보면 알 수 있습니다. 위는 변경한 코드 모습입니다. 이제 버튼 색상이 변경 가능 해집니다! 버튼 색상 변경 두번째 방법 - Button 형식 변경 xml에서 ..
![[코틀린/변수] var과 val의 차이를 알아보자](https://img1.daumcdn.net/thumb/R750x0/?scode=mtistory2&fname=https%3A%2F%2Fblog.kakaocdn.net%2Fdna%2FDVWCy%2FbtsEZoV08Zg%2FAAAAAAAAAAAAAAAAAAAAAPuIlJZOo4q_FOSwVb8gMQDiNEEmUYt-R1qSI4SGagZx%2Fimg.png%3Fcredential%3DyqXZFxpELC7KVnFOS48ylbz2pIh7yKj8%26expires%3D1756652399%26allow_ip%3D%26allow_referer%3D%26signature%3DC1bZD5KTzy3rKlug%252B8YT0QoQ6bc%253D)
변수란? 변수 (Variable)란 수학적으로 가변적인, 변할 수 있는 숫자를 뜻한다. 하지만 프로그래밍에서 뜻하는 변수는 "값을 저장할 수 있는 공간"을 뜻한다. var과 val의 차이점 var: 가변(Mutable) 변수로, 값의 읽기와 쓰기가 모두 허용되는 변수이다. 또한 변수(Variable)의 약자이다. val: 불변(Immutable) 변수로, 값의 읽기만 허용되는 변수이다. 또한 값(Value)의 약자이다. var (Variable)에 값을 할당 한다면 // var ( Variable ) fun main() { var num = 20 // num 이라는 변수에 20을 할당 해준다. println(num) // 20이 출력이된다. num = 30 // num 이라는 변수에 다시 30을 할당 해..
![[안드로이드/카카오 오븐] 프로토 타이핑 툴 - 앱 기획](https://img1.daumcdn.net/thumb/R750x0/?scode=mtistory2&fname=https%3A%2F%2Fblog.kakaocdn.net%2Fdna%2FdYZTIm%2FbtsB3vQ3scI%2FAAAAAAAAAAAAAAAAAAAAAMdF7O49il7EWZv24FCMWfJRekr0L-Am27q3Rih7aS6l%2Fimg.png%3Fcredential%3DyqXZFxpELC7KVnFOS48ylbz2pIh7yKj8%26expires%3D1756652399%26allow_ip%3D%26allow_referer%3D%26signature%3Dtrhizspi1HNGSvoWZYmtqguRikA%253D)
OvenApp.io Oven(오븐)은 HTML5 기반의 무료 웹/앱 프로토타이핑 툴입니다. (카카오 제공) ovenapp.io 안녕하세요 주코딩입니다. 오늘은 처음으로 안드로이드에 대한 꿀팁을 알려드리려고 합니다. 첫 번째 꿀팁은 앱 기획 시 유용한 프로토 타이핑 툴 '카카오 오븐'입니다! ❓ 다음카카오 오븐이란? 2014년 11월 베타버전으로 외부에 공개한 앱, 웹 프로토타입 툴입니다. 즉, 앱 또는 웹 기획 단계에서 '프로젝트 모형'을 제작할 수 있습니다. HTML5 기반의 무료 앱. 웹 제작 프로토타입 툴로 본격적인 개발에 앞서, 레이아웃을 제작한 후 PC는 물론 스마트폰, 태블 릿과 같은 모바일 디바이스 환경에서 넘김 등을 직접 손으로 터치하며 테스트할 수 있습니다. 혹시나 해서 말씀드립니다. 앱..